A Computational Biologist uses data analysis and computational methods to address biological issues, focusing on genetic and genomic data analysis.

Computational Biologist careers

For those aspiring to embark on a rewarding career as a Computational Biologist, the Computational Biologist courses in Darwin provide essential training and qualifications. These courses are formulated to equip students with critical skills in biology, data analysis, and computational techniques, making them highly valuable in today’s job market. Darwin, with its unique biodiversity, presents an ideal backdrop for the application of these skills in research and development.

To become an effective Computational Biologist, you will need a robust foundation in both biological sciences and data sciences. In addition to the specialised computational training offered in Darwin, prospective students should consider exploring Science courses to gain broader insights into scientific principles. These courses will enhance your understanding of biology, which is crucial for fields such as Biology and Data Sciences.

The career opportunities for a Computational Biologist are diverse and can lead to promising roles in various sectors, especially in Darwin's vibrant scientific community. Graduates may find themselves pursuing careers as a Data Scientist, Big Data Engineer, or Data Analyst. Each of these roles leverages the analytical skills gained through specialised training to solve complex biological problems and interpret large datasets.

Additionally, as you advance your education in Computational Biology, consider related job roles such as Machine Learning Engineer or AI Engineer, which utilise advanced algorithms to enhance biological research. Exploring positions such as Data Modeller or even working as a Laboratory Assistant can provide invaluable experience in the field, enriching your professional journey.

Beyond technical positions, a career in Computational Biology can extend to roles such as Ecologist or Toxicologist, where your competencies would contribute to environmental and health-based research.
